President John F. Kennedy and State Governors sign the Interstate-Federal Compact for the Delaware River Basin (H.J. 225 Public Law 87328). Seated (L-R): Governor of New Jersey Robert B. Meyner, Governor of Delaware Elbert N. Carvel, Governor of Pennsylvania David L. Lawrence, and President Kennedy. Also included in the photograph are H. Mat Adams, Commissioner of the Department of Conservation and Economic Development (far left); Mayor of Philadelphia Richardson Dilworth (standing behind Governor Lawrence); Maurice K. Goddard, Secretary of the Pennsylvania Department of Forests and Waters (standing behind President Kennedy); and Vincent G. Terenzio, New York City Board of Water Supply (to the right of Mr. Goddard). All others are unidentified. Oval Office, White House, Washington, D.C.
